Veteran Nollywood performer Chinedu Ikedieze, called Aki, has talked openly about the difficulties he encountered as a child as a result of his diagnosis of stunted growth.
The actor claimed that after hearing his doctor tell his mother about his issue, he grew concerned and contemplated suicide because he was being teased by other kids because he wasn’t developing normally.
He revealed this in a current interview with well-known media figure Chude Jideonwo.
Ikedieze claims, “When I was nine years and six months old, something happened. The doctor informed my mother, “Madam, what he has is stunted growth,” in my memory.
“At that point, I began to hear the terms stunted growth and delayed growth. I sobbed countless times because I experienced bullying at school and even at home since my growth was inadequate. It became so horrible that I occasionally considered quitting everything. Because the Third Mainland Bridge is not close by, thank God I have not grown for Lagos.
He expressed his gratitude to his mother for supporting him during those trying times.
Ikedieze continued by saying that when he first met Osita Iheme, aka Pawpaw, “there was this chemistry there.”
